      Something to note about these boards is that there are bios mods that allow you to take the single core boost and apply it to all cores, as well as unlock the fsb for overclocking, so you could theoretically take a 2.6ghz base 2640v3 and take it to 3.84ghz all core with a 113 fsb.

    Mainboard is quad channel memory capable, 7.1 channel audio by realtek 892 chip. CPU VRM area is populated with 5+10 capacitors, provides good stability. x99 platform is aging, this year CPU's patched by Intel. So, there is no need to pay a lot for a mainboard. Latest DDR4 rams are not good fit for this mainboard, because around 2400MHz DDR4 is the highest limit for Xeon v4's. New DDR4's went 3200 to 4000 so be careful when buying, low spd timings must be checked for being sure on the module. If you are a montage fan, choose a v4 Xeon for 4K montage for use with Magix Vegas version 17, which is the minimum specs for it. Only drawback is, there are no 3.1 USB ports.     The V3 Xeon CPUs are actually much faster than the V2 CPUs if you flash the bios with the microcode fix that allows the single core turbo boost on all cores. Currently the xeon e5 2678 V3 can be found for less than 100 USD. V4 CPUs sadly do not have the same bug as V3 and therefore cannot be run at max single turbo on all cores

      @driesverbraeken5402 2 ปีที่แล้ว

      It does support non-ECC memory. That's because there's only one socket. Mind you: if you want to have quad-channel you do have to populate all 4 slots (either ECC or non-ECC). If there were two sockets then ECC would be mandatory.
